The 940 Civil Engineer Squadron (AFRC) is a unit within the United States Air Force Reserve Command (AFRC). It primarily specializes in civil engineering tasks, which encompass various aspects of base and facility operations, such as construction, maintenance, and emergency services. These duties include managing infrastructure projects, ensuring facility safety, and providing support during natural disasters or emergencies. The squadron’s primary location is at Joint Base Lewis-McChord in Washington State, although it may be deployed elsewhere when necessary for mission requirements.
